Ticket: Staging env misconfigured for Siftgate bloom filter

The bloom layer in front of the Pellet KV store is rejecting all lookups in staging because the env file was copied from the dev template without credentials. False-positive tuning values are fine; only the auth line is missing. To unblock the weekly demo, the Pellet admission secret must be set on the following line.

env line for yaguf-fajop: LEDGER_TOKEN13=fb08984397349

Subject: Joint Venture Proposal — Astervale Partnership

Executive team,

For the finance team's awareness: Astervale Logistics has proposed a joint venture covering distribution in the Kelmarsh corridor. Initial terms suggest a 60/40 equity split in our favour, with shared warehousing costs. Due diligence begins next month; preliminary modelling shows breakeven within two years. Please hold questions until the review call. The confidential summary of our negotiating position is set out below.

board note of kageg-bahof: The renewal with Holwynax Holdings closes at $2 million a year, 5 percent below the last contract. Project Ulaath slips by two quarters because of the supplier delay.

Step 4: Promote the FareLogic rules engine to production. Before deploying, run the tariff regression suite against the Quarrydale staging cluster and confirm all shipping-fee rules compile without warnings. The bundle must be signed before the orchestrator will accept it; unsigned bundles are silently rejected, which has bitten maintainers before. Sign using the release key below, which is rotated quarterly by the platform team.

deploy key for kajof-fajop: bky6_gDHw9Q